What are no KYC / casinos that do not have verification within the UK?
For UK searches, “no verification casino” typically means offshore websites that are friendly to UK residents where:
-
The registration process is simple (minimal field),
-
Quick deposits are possible (especially via crypto),
-
verification may not be requested until the trigger occurs.
This is distinct from casinos licensed by the UKGC that have to verify the identity of gamblers prior to playing.
It’s a trade-off is that UKGC sites offer stronger protections for players from the UK; sites outside may provide lower friction but operate under different oversight and dispute resolution procedures.

Bitcoin withdrawals and deposits
Crypto typically helps reduce friction because it can be used to avoid certain banking steps:
-
you deposit from a wallet address
-
withdrawals go back to your wallet
-
speed is contingent on the casino’s approval speed depends on casino approval network confirmations (and charges).
Tips for keeping withdrawals and deposits in the same rail (don’t bank with credit cards and then withdraw to crypto or reverse) in the event that the website allows it — mixing processes can trigger extra checks.
Verification will trigger (common reasons you suddenly get asked to produce ID)
-
Massive withdrawals and sudden win spikes
-
Audits of bonuses (wagering conformity, maximum bets, rules for betting, games not excluded)
-
Account security flags (VPN/device changing, numerous logins, odd IP patterns)
-
AML/source of funds checks (bigger transactions draw scrutiny)
-
Payment not matching (name doesn’t correspond, payment method used by third-party)
“No KYC” compares to “light AML ” checks”
If a website advertises “no KYC” some still perform security-based checks — particularly for AML requirements. UKGC guidelines explain identity verification expectations in regulated settings, and explains why checks may be necessary related to withdrawals or legal obligations.
Are no KYC casinos safe for UK players?
The word “safe” doesn’t mean “perfect” — it means you can reduce the risk through a smart choice.
Licensing and oversight
Offshore licences are diverse in their strictness. A license badge isn’t enough. Search for:
-
An operator entity with a clear name,
-
Terms published, KYC policy, and withdrawal policies,
-
an active complaints/dispute route.
Security signals
Find:
-
SSL/HTTPS on all pages.
-
explicit policies and limits
-
independent audit mentions (RNG testing) (where applicable)
-
strong reputation signals (consistent feedback from users with time).
Responsible gambling tools
You should choose casinos that offer:
-
Limits on deposits,
-
time-out/cool-off,
-
self-exclusion options,
-
session timers/realistic checks.
For UK support and tools, see GambleAware (support and blocking/self-exclusion guidance), UKGC’s “organisations that can help”, and NHS resources.
Red flags checklist
Beware of casinos that have several red flags
-
unclear or unclear or
-
“guaranteed no verification ever” claims,
-
unclear licensing information or broken licence links,
-
Recurrent delays in withdrawing without explanation,
-
ineffective support (no online chat/email responses),
-
The most lucrative bonuses (high wagering, but with low cashout + strict max bet rules).

FAQ – No KYC / No Verification Casinos UK
What is “no verification” actually refer to?
Usually this means that you sign up in a short time and less screenings in the beginning. But verification might still take place later, if something triggers an review.
Can a non-KYC casino be able to still request documents?
Yes. Massive withdrawals, bonus audits or unusual activity AML/security checks can trigger verification.
Are casinos with no IDs permissible with regard to UK clients?
UK players are able to play at offshore sites, but they are not UKGC-licensed and don’t offer the identical UK legal protections. Casinos that have UKGC licenses must validate your identity before you gamble.
What are the fastest methods of withdrawal?
Typically crypto (once accepted) as settlement through blockchain can be faster than banking — but fees and confirmations will apply.
What makes verification checks more likely?
Big withdrawals in addition to bonus compliance checks device switching or VPN, payment mismatches as well as AML/source of funds flags.
What are the bonuses that work at Crypto casinos?
Usually identical to casinos that are fiat in terms of wagering requirement, eligible games, maximum cashout and time limits. Promos may raise scrutiny at the time of withdrawal.
How can I identify an unsafe casino?
Avoid the ambiguous licensing, unclear terms, “guaranteed no KYC ever” marketing, frequent withdrawal delays, as well as weak support.
What happens if I lose my access to my credit card or wallet?
Treat your security in the wallet with seriousness: back recover phrases to a safe place, enable account security features and refrain from sharing access. If you’re unable confirm ownership later, cashouts may be blocked.
